Transaction 40fd3664117cf869a1313eecd9bf0565ab3b73bb86e16f355d86cffbbf5b3446

3 Input
2 Outputs
  • 40fd3664117cf869a1313eecd9bf0565ab3b73bb86e16f355d86cffbbf5b3446:0
  • value  950819
    address  1LFwKsQqexTozK7jSFf3EgPr13A7TimwkK
  • 40fd3664117cf869a1313eecd9bf0565ab3b73bb86e16f355d86cffbbf5b3446:1
  • value  11051771
    address  39fBic4S8qVNLvu2vFV5NDBZh8EbviZCYZ